Transaction 18fcca76eabdd0ad4cb72a33f43139814246a7d10dcb4b6b0dd885d030c508e6

1 Input
2 Outputs
  • 18fcca76eabdd0ad4cb72a33f43139814246a7d10dcb4b6b0dd885d030c508e6:0
  • value  909
    address  1DDycCr2NkMatH781Ec3EzSsBYU2eomo8Q
  • 18fcca76eabdd0ad4cb72a33f43139814246a7d10dcb4b6b0dd885d030c508e6:1
  • value  656818
    address  3EFondetrmto7rS3AVZDN4zYuaoeWaiB6p